Why Green Packaging Is a Game-Changer

Packaging waste now dumps an eye-popping 120 million tonnes of plastic into the sea each year. Cosmetics, oddly, add more to that mountain than most people think. Standard cream jars usually arrive wrapped in plastic film, packed in bubble wrap, then cushioned with foam inserts. Switch to simple paper-based boxes, and much of that flow vanishes fast. Good cream boxes use kraft sheets, corrugated board, and plant-based fillers that calmly return to the soil or the bin.

Core Features of Quality Cream Storage Boxes

A decent cream box needs to hit three friendly targets: guard the product, honor the planet, and still sit pretty on the shelf. Scan this quick checklist:

  •       Durability: Tough corrugated dividers or molded pulp cradles stop glass jars slipping or cracking on the journey.
  •       Eco-Friendliness: You can use recycled shipboard, FSC paper, and soy ink so the waste and toxins can stay low
  •       Design Appeal: Unique colors, simple lines and gentle texture can catch the customer's eye easily

Innovations in Cream Box Packaging Materials

Three new materials are changing the game:

  •   Mushroom mycelium inserts: These replace foam and break down in weeks.
  •   Algae-based bioplastics: They shrug off moisture but return to nature.
  •   Bagasse or sugar-cane fiber: Waste from sugar mills that makes tough, light boxes.

Lifecycle Analysis: Quantifying Your Impact

Yet green words mean little without numbers. A full life-cycle assessment checks every step from field to landfill, pinpointing where emissions hide. The Custom Boxes team partners with brands to map these flows and spot hot-spot areas.
